The invention relates to heat engineering and can be used in heat pump units for air heating, cooling and hot water supply of individual residential buildings and individual structures designed to operate in conditions of electricity shortage due to the use of heat of combustion of fuel and low potential heat of surface aquifers of groundwater and the soil itself. When the unit is operating in the heat pump mode, low-grade heat is taken from the thermal aquifers of the underground water and soil mass through heat transfer during the circulation of the heat carrier in the gravitational heat pipe 16. The heat carrier is circulated under the influence of thermogravitational forces using heat exchangers 18 and 19. When the unit is operating in the refrigeration mode The machine switches three-way valves 20 and low-grade heat is taken from the cooling system (air conditioning in zduha) evaporator 19 and a condenser 14 is passed by the heat exchanger 16 hot water supply system due to commit vapor compression refrigeration cycle.
